New Delhi, Jan. 19 -- Virat Kohli's century was in vain as New Zealand won its first ODI bilateral series on Indian soil with a 41-run victory in the third and final match on Sunday.

The Black Caps won the series 2-1 with Daryl Mitchell scoring 137 runs off 131 balls and Glenn Phillips hitting an 88-ball 106 as New Zealand reached 337-8 in its 50 overs.

In reply, Kohli led the Indian chase with 124 off 108 balls - his 54th ODI century - but the hosts were bowled out for 296 in 46 overs.
